10-year-old dog stolen from Greenbelt apartment (Photo)

WASHINGTON — Police are searching for a dog that was stolen during a break-in at a Prince George’s County apartment Wednesday.

A suspect broke into an apartment in the 7000 block of Hanover Parkway some time between 10:45 a.m. and 2:45 p.m. Wednesday and stole 10-year-old Arwyn, according to police.

The suspect also took a diamond ring, a laptop and a Kindle Fire.

“Please help us find Arwyn and bring her back to her worried owner,” police wrote in a release.

Police did not release information about Arwyn’s breed or size.
